Output d59ef4d1b30a30edfef6f3ab18d797c12ef85f18c24b60cc8da3d18d4723a693:0

value
17386422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39393ceca65785518fb2e73eb6cebe31a439b612 OP_EQUALVERIFY OP_CHECKSIG
address
16Da5uAKP2xTomVJ3oDQYuBFRED8BiMw41
transaction
d59ef4d1b30a30edfef6f3ab18d797c12ef85f18c24b60cc8da3d18d4723a693
spent
true